sun
verb
/sũ̄/
spelling unconfirmed
Definitions
-
to cry
Wọ́n ń sun ẹkún níbi ìsìnkú They're crying at the burial ground
-
to chant
Ọdẹ ni ó máa ń sun ìjálá, ìyàwó ni ó máa ń sun ẹkún-ìyàwó Hunters chant ìjálá, and brides chant the ẹkún-ìyàwó
